如何为PHP建站源码添加多语言支持?

2025-01-21 00:00:00 作者:网络

在当今全球化的时代,网站的多语言支持成为了一个非常重要的功能。它不仅能够提升用户体验,还能扩大网站的受众范围。对于使用PHP开发的网站来说,实现多语言支持同样是一个重要且可行的任务。接下来我们将一步步介绍如何为PHP建站源码添加多语言支持。

1. 准备工作

在开始之前,您需要确保您的服务器环境已经正确配置,并安装了适当的PHP版本。还需要确认所使用的数据库和框架是否兼容多语言设置。

2. 创建语言文件

为了实现多语言支持,首先应该创建包含不同语言文本信息的语言文件。通常这些文件会被放置在一个特定的目录下(如 /languages/ 或者 /locale/ )。每种语言都有自己独立的文件,例如 english.php, french.php 等等。在这些文件中定义变量来存储各种字符串:

php
‘Welcome’,
‘home’ => ‘Home’,
// 更多词条…
];
?>

3. 加载相应的语言包

当用户访问网站时,系统需要根据用户的偏好选择合适的语言包进行加载。这可以通过检测浏览器的语言设置或让用户自行选择语言来完成。一旦确定了目标语言,则可以通过 include() 或 require_once() 函数引入对应的 PHP 文件。

4. 替换硬编码文本

接下来要做的就是替换页面上的所有硬编码文本,将它们替换成从语言文件中获取的内容。例如,在 HTML 模板中可以这样写:

这样做可以使同一段代码适用于多种语言,而无需重复编写。

5. 实现动态切换功能

为了让用户能够在不刷新页面的情况下即时切换语言,您可以考虑使用 J*aScript 和 AJAX 技术。当用户选择了新的语言后,通过 AJAX 请求发送给服务器端脚本处理,然后更新页面上的内容而不重载整个页面。

6. 测试与优化

最后一步是全面测试各个部分的功能,确保所有语言都能正常显示并且没有错别字等问题。同时也要注意性能方面的影响,避免过多地消耗资源。如果可能的话,还可以对代码进行一些优化,比如缓存常用的语言数据等。

以上就是关于如何为PHP建站源码添加多语言支持的基本步骤。虽然看起来有点复杂,但只要按照上述流程一步一步来操作,相信很快就能成功实现这一功能。


# 潮流网站建设北路  # 网站建设客服工作  # 盘县手机网站建设  # 新基建网站建设  # 陕西推广网站建设  # 新河网站建设咨询报价  # 新干网站建设  # 靠谱的网站建设案例  # 阜宁网站建设企业  # 磐石网站建设哪家好  # 企业手机网站建设规定  # 丹东企业网站建设费用  # 长沙网站是模板建设吗  # 荔浦网站建设厂家  # 专业网站建设论文怎么写  # 网站注意事项及建设  # 网站建设存在风险  # 文娱部门网站建设流程  # 滁州网站建设建站系统  # 残联网站建设情况 


相关栏目: 【 SEO优化2895 】 【 网络营销10 】 【 网站运营10 】 【 网络技术17278 】 【 网络推广11033

猜你喜欢

联络方式:

4007654355

邮箱:915688610@qq.com

Q Q:915688610

微信二维码
在线咨询 拨打电话

电话

4007654355

微信二维码

微信二维码